CEL with P0326, P1123, P1125 advice for a newbie.

Hey all! Newbie ‘99 986 Boxster owner, I’m getting a reoccurring CEL with P0326, P1123, P1125. I’ve cleared it once and drove for a bit with no issue. Today after a bit of driving and giving it a bit more throttle, this code combo popped up again. I did notice some hesitation at 5-6k rpm. I’m still on the first tank of gas since purchase and apparently it was sitting for a bit.

For the P1123 and P1125, I’m thinking of trying some fuel injector cleaner. Possibly a fuel filter change. Is this a good starting point?

Looking for some advice on the P0326 - Knock sensor 1. This one sounds scary, but is it just that there is an issue with the sensor? Or, caused by the other codes? Or did it detect a knock which sounds bad.
